psGroupCaption - cWebMenuItem
Caption to be displayed if the menu item is the beginning of a new menu group
Type: Property
Access: Read/Write
Data Type: String
Parameters: None
Syntax
{ WebProperty=Client }
Property String psGroupCaption
| Access Type | Syntax |
|---|---|
| Read Access: | WebGet psGroupCaption to StringVariable |
| Write Access: | WebSet psGroupCaption to StringVariable/Value |
Description
When pbBeginGroup is set to True, a group divider is drawn above this item. Some menu styles also support separate captions for groups.
Set psGroupCaption to the caption text you want to display when pbBeginGroup is True.
Note: The group caption is only displayed if it is supported by the host menu object and the web application's theme (psTheme).
About Web Properties
Each web property maintains two values: The regular property value is set during object creation and should not be changed during the lifetime of that object. To access that value, use the standard property Get and Set syntax.
The web property value is the local value stored at each client. This is synchronized to the client's local value whenever a server call is being processed. To access the web property value, use the WebGet and WebSet syntax above instead of the standard Get and Set syntax.
